Performance and Powertrain Options
When it comes to full-size pickup trucks, performance is critical. Both the Chevrolet Silverado 1500 and the Ford F-150 offer a variety of engine options to suit every driver’s needs.
- Chevrolet Silverado 1500: The Silverado 1500 offers a choice of five engines, ranging from a fuel-efficient 2.7L Turbo to a heavy-duty 6.2L V8. The available Duramax 3.0L Turbo-Diesel engine delivers an impressive 277 horsepower and 460 lb-ft of torque while providing class-leading fuel efficiency. Additionally, the Silverado’s Dynamic Fuel Management technology seamlessly optimizes power and efficiency during various driving scenarios.
- Ford F-150: The F-150 provides a selection of six engines, including a 3.0L Power Stroke V6 Turbo Diesel and a high-output 3.5L V6 EcoBoost. The available hybrid powertrain combines an electric motor with a 3.5L V6 engine, offering both power and fuel economy for eco-conscious drivers.
Both trucks deliver powerful and efficient performance, but the Silverado’s class-leading fuel economy sets it apart for drivers looking to save at the pump.
Towing Capacity and Payload
One of the key features buyers look for in a pickup truck is towing capacity and payload. Both the Silverado 1500 and F-150 boast impressive numbers, but the Silverado takes a slight edge.
- Chevrolet Silverado 1500: The Silverado 1500 can tow up to 13,300 pounds when properly equipped, more than enough for the average driver’s needs. Its maximum payload capacity reaches 2,280 pounds, providing ample support for loading up materials or equipment.
- Ford F-150: The F-150 can tow up to 14,000 pounds depending on the configuration and features a maximum payload capacity of 3,325 pounds.
While the F-150 claims higher maximum towing and payload capacities, the Silverado 1500 still presents a more than capable option for most drivers.
Technology and Features
The Chevrolet Silverado 1500 and Ford F-150 both excel when it comes to advanced technology and comfortable amenities.
- Chevrolet Silverado 1500: The Silverado comes standard with an intuitive infotainment system with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ility. The available Wi-Fi hotspot keeps you connected while on the go, and the myChevrolet Mobile App offers smartphone integration to remotely control features like door lock/unlock and remote start. Advanced safety features such as Forward Collision Alert, Lane Change Alert, and Adaptive Cruise Control all contribute to a safer driving experience.
- Ford F-150: The F-150 features the SYNC 4 infotainment system with available smartphone connectivity through Ford+Alexa and Apple CarPlay. The available Pro Trailer Backup Assist helps to optimize trailer control while reversing. The F-150 also offers advanced safety options through the Ford Co-Pilot360 system, including Pre-Collision Assist, Lane-Keeping System, and Adaptive Cruise Control.
While both trucks are packed with technology and safety features, the choice may ultimately depend on your brand and interface preferences.
Customization Options
The Chevrolet Silverado 1500 and Ford F-150 offer a wide range of customization options, including various trim levels, colors, and packages to help create the perfect truck for your unique needs.
- Chevrolet Silverado 1500: With eight distinct trim levels, from the work-ready WT to the luxurious High Country, the Silverado 1500 has a model for every driver. The Trail Boss trims cater to off-road enthusiasts with lifted suspension, skid plates, and all-terrain tires. Plus, with a variety of exterior colors and interior options, the Silverado 1500 can truly be tailored to your preferences.
- Ford F-150: The F-150 provides seven trim levels, ranging from the basic XL to the premium Limited. Off-road fans may opt for the Raptor trim, featuring a high-performance suspension and unique exterior design elements. Similar to the Silverado, the F-150 offers an assortment of colors and interior materials for maximum personalization.
Both vehicles cater to individualization and offer ample opportunities for customization, making them appealing to a wide array of drivers.
